草庐IT

解决oracle死锁,生产问题,ORA-00060: deadlock detected while waiting for resource,

目录项目场景:问题描述原因分析:解决方案:其他解决方案:项目场景:oracle数据库在做大量的批量更新同一张表数据。问题描述早上来公司去生产环境查grelog日志,发现ERROR日志,点进去看后报如下错误:ORA-00060:deadlockdetectedwhilewaitingforresource原因分析:从错误的中一看就知道oracle数据库发生了死锁。去生产的log日志查看,发现同一时间点左右,还有一个批量更新同一条数据的慢sql日志。这个慢sql的更新和这个死锁的sql更新互斥了。导致了死锁。死锁的异常抛出后,这个慢sql就执行成功了。在本地也写单元测试实例,跑出了同样的结果。猜测

Paper Reading - Loss系列 - Focal Loss for Dense Object Detection

确实发现大神的文章都比较简单明了实用-ICCV2017计算机视觉-Paper&Code-知乎Abstracthttps://arxiv.org/abs/1708.02002https://arxiv.org/abs/1708.02002总结主要为以下几点OHEM算法虽然增加了错分类样本的数量,但是直接把容易样本扔掉了,可会导致过杀率上升,作者同时也做了对比实验,AP有3.+的提升FocalLoss可以通过减少易分类样本的权重,使得模型在训练时更专注于难分类的样本下面这张图展示了FocalLoss取不同的gama时的损失函数下降。Algorithm文章对最基本的对交叉熵进行改进,作为本文实验的b

jQuery 事件 : Detect changes to the html/text of a div

我有一个div,它的内容一直在变化,无论是ajax请求、jquery函数、blur等等。有没有一种方法可以在任何时间检测到我的div上的任何变化?我不想使用任何间隔或检查默认值。这样就可以了$('mydiv').contentchanged(){alert('changed')} 最佳答案 如果你不想使用计时器并检查innerHTML你可以试试这个事件$('mydiv').on('DOMSubtreeModified',function(){console.log('changed');});更多详细信息和浏览器支持数据是Here.

jQuery 事件 : Detect changes to the html/text of a div

我有一个div,它的内容一直在变化,无论是ajax请求、jquery函数、blur等等。有没有一种方法可以在任何时间检测到我的div上的任何变化?我不想使用任何间隔或检查默认值。这样就可以了$('mydiv').contentchanged(){alert('changed')} 最佳答案 如果你不想使用计时器并检查innerHTML你可以试试这个事件$('mydiv').on('DOMSubtreeModified',function(){console.log('changed');});更多详细信息和浏览器支持数据是Here.

javascript - 检测浏览器 TLS 兼容性

我们有一个SSL网站,该网站的主机最近禁用了较旧的SSL协议(protocol),如TLS1.0及更低版本。根据浏览器的不同,如果网站访问者使用的浏览器不支持至少TLS1.1,则他们在访问网站时会收到空白页面或神秘的错误消息。我希望创建一个不在SSL端口上的登录页面,如果它支持TLS1.1及更高版本,我可以在其中检测浏览器功能。如果没有,那么我想向他们显示一条友好的消息,以升级他们的浏览器或使用不同的浏览器。这是否可以使用客户端javascript库来完成?如果是这样,那么我应该使用什么?谢谢。 最佳答案 您可以使用theAPI由H

javascript - 检测浏览器 TLS 兼容性

我们有一个SSL网站,该网站的主机最近禁用了较旧的SSL协议(protocol),如TLS1.0及更低版本。根据浏览器的不同,如果网站访问者使用的浏览器不支持至少TLS1.1,则他们在访问网站时会收到空白页面或神秘的错误消息。我希望创建一个不在SSL端口上的登录页面,如果它支持TLS1.1及更高版本,我可以在其中检测浏览器功能。如果没有,那么我想向他们显示一条友好的消息,以升级他们的浏览器或使用不同的浏览器。这是否可以使用客户端javascript库来完成?如果是这样,那么我应该使用什么?谢谢。 最佳答案 您可以使用theAPI由H

javascript - 使用 jQuery 检测表单输入的自动完成

我有一个表单可以检测每个keyup()和focus()上的所有文本字段是否有效;如果它们都有效,它将启用提交按钮供用户按下。但是,如果用户使用浏览器自动完成功能填写其中一个文本输入,则会阻止启用提交按钮。有没有一种方法可以使用jQuery来检测是否有任何输入已更改,而不管它是如何更改的? 最佳答案 您可以尝试使用oninput在ctrl中检测基于文本的更改(除了shift和等键)的。例如:$(input).on('input',function(){console.log($(this).val());});

javascript - 使用 jQuery 检测表单输入的自动完成

我有一个表单可以检测每个keyup()和focus()上的所有文本字段是否有效;如果它们都有效,它将启用提交按钮供用户按下。但是,如果用户使用浏览器自动完成功能填写其中一个文本输入,则会阻止启用提交按钮。有没有一种方法可以使用jQuery来检测是否有任何输入已更改,而不管它是如何更改的? 最佳答案 您可以尝试使用oninput在ctrl中检测基于文本的更改(除了shift和等键)的。例如:$(input).on('input',function(){console.log($(this).val());});

【开放域目标检测】一:Open-Vocabulary Object Detection Using Captions论文讲解

出发点是制定一种更加通用的目标检测问题,目的是借助于大量的image-caption数据来覆盖更多的objectconcept,使得objectdetection不再受限于带标注数据的少数类别,从而实现更加泛化的objectdetection,识别出更多novel的物体类别。文章目录一、背景&动机二、Open-Vocabulary的简单引入三、Open-Vocabulary/zero-shot/weaklysupervised之间的差异四、论文的核心五、论文流程六、模型结果对比一、背景&动机尽管深度神经网络在目标检测方面具有显著的准确性,但由于监管要求,它们的训练和拓展成本很高。特别是,学习更

Javascript:如何检测单词是否突出显示

我正在编写一个Firefox插件,只要突出显示一个单词就会触发它。但是,我需要一个脚本来检测某个单词何时被突出显示,但我被卡住了。一个例子是nytimes.com(当您阅读一篇文章并突出显示一个词时,会弹出引用图标)。然而,nytimes.com脚本非常复杂。我今年16岁,不是一个程序员,所以这绝对不适合我。 最佳答案 最简单的方法是检测文档上的mouseup和keyup事件,并检查是否有任何文本被选中。以下将适用于所有主要浏览器。示例:http://www.jsfiddle.net/timdown/SW54T/functionge